Sodus Point Historic Lighthouse

Built in 1871 (by congressional order) for $14,000, lighthouse overlooks Lake Ontario and Great Sodus Bay, and replaced one built in 1825.  Initially using 12 reflectored oil lamps, it guided ships until 1901.  House was keeper's residence.  Listed in National Registry of Historic Places - 1977; property transferred to Town of Sodus - 1984; dedicated by Sodus bay Historical Society as Maritime Museum - 1985.
